SYNC I/O is locked to word clock. It IS possible, by using the SYNC I/O’s Loop Sync In and setting the Apogee interface’s Word Clock Ratio setting so the sample rate of the interface is at the desired setting while the clock system runs at a 44.1/48k multiple.
Digilink Connections Like Digidesign interfaces, the AMBus HD card is equipped with two ports, Primary and Expansion. Please note that the Primary Port on the AMBus HD card is the LEFT connector when looking from the back of the unit.
��������� As the audio I/O of Apogee interfaces differs from that of a 192 I/O, a connected Apogee interface will ignore all settings in the Hardware Setup which pertain to audio I/O on the hardware. To define how audio I/O on an Apo- gee interface is routed to the 32 I/O busses (through the AMBus HD card), settings should be configured from...
Again, Apogee interfaces will follow session sample rates if the Core card interface is locked internally or to a SYNC I/O. When Apogee hardware is locked to an external clock source such as Big Ben, be sure to set the hardware clock rate to correspond to the session sample rate.
• Be sure to connect interfaces in the order indicated. • With the AMBus HD card, the AD-8000 can interface directly with Pro Tools at sample rates up to 48k. The Trak2 can interface with Pro Tools at sample rates up to 96k.

Configuring the AMBus HD Card P15 Jumper Settings The AMBus HD card is shipped with Jumper P15 installed. This jumper insures that an AD-8000 connected first in a series of interfaces will follow the sample rate set by Pro Tools.
Due to the space constraints associated with AMbus card slots, the MIDI connector necessary for performing firmware upgrades on the AMBus HD card was removed prior to shipping. Please contact Apogee in the event that you need to update your card.
